Rajasthan has experienced its wettest July in 69 years, with cumulative rainfall of 285 mm recorded across the state, according to the Meteorological Centre in Jaipur. The last time Rajasthan saw such heavy July rainfall was in 1956, when the state recorded 308 mm rainfall. This marks a 77%-surplus compared to the state's long-period average of 161.4 mm for July.
